(KNSI) – The St. Cloud compost site has announced its 2024 season will end on Saturday, November 23rd.

The date is weather-dependent, so don’t wait until the last minute if you don’t have to. Area residents use the location to dispose of yard waste from grass clippings and leaves to brush and tree stumps. As trees lose their leaves later than normal this year, it may butt up against the end of the season.

Annual permits are required to use the St. Cloud River Bluffs Regional Park Compost Site. They cost between $30 and $50, depending on your category. Hours are noon to 6:00 p.m. on Monday, Tuesday, and Thursday. It shifts to 1:00 p.m. to 7:00 p.m. on Friday and 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. on Saturday. The compost pile is located near County Road 75 on 33rd Street South.
